Output 15f7bafc280d9d518efc6b41ffcd21ee75d56ee04fbb6228e7a885c08abbd512:0

value
12968206
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3ddb15e5b06c020e19666657de055ef00d4d6d15 OP_EQUALVERIFY OP_CHECKSIG
address
16e4g2qBZGWDciLZToxBN1DHFoF8iRteqb
transaction
15f7bafc280d9d518efc6b41ffcd21ee75d56ee04fbb6228e7a885c08abbd512
spent
true